四大偽類,css鼠標樣式設置,reset操作,靜止對文本操作


07.31自我總結

一.a標簽的四大偽類

  • a:link{樣式} 未訪問時的狀態(鼠標點擊前顯示的狀態)
  • a:hover{樣式} 鼠標懸停時的狀態
  • a:visited{樣式} 已訪問過的狀態(鼠標點擊后的狀態)
  • a:active{樣式} 鼠標點擊時的狀態

補充

  • input:focus{樣式} 點擊后鼠標移開保持鼠標點擊時的狀態
  • 上述中的hover,active也適合普通標簽
    父級 兄弟:hover ~ 自身 {}
    自身:hover {}

注意:(只有在< a href=" "></ a>時標簽中有效)

二.css鼠標樣式設置

cursor是樣式中的一種屬性代表光標

cursor語法:auto | crosshair | default | hand | move | help | wait | text | w-resize |s-resize | n-resize |e-resize | ne-resize |sw-resize | se-resize | nw-resize |pointer | url (url)

布局設置:

  • p{ cursor: text; } :設置鼠標移動到p標簽對象時鼠標變為文本選擇樣式
  • a { cursor: pointer; }:設置鼠標移動到a超鏈接對象時鼠標變為手指形狀(鏈接選擇)
  • body{ cursor: url("小圖片地址")}:設置鼠標指針默認為一個小圖片
  • 也可以結合a標簽的四大偽類結合使用

注意:

cursor:url都是和偽類結合使用,而且書寫格式要cursor:url(鏈接),auto;

三.reset操作

  • 在開發中往往用不到四種偽類,且要清除掉系統的默認樣式

  • 就可以如下對a標簽進行樣式設置:清除系統默認樣式 - reset操作

    • 代碼如下
    a {
        color: black; <!--清除他的顏色-->
        text-decoration: none; <!--清除超鏈接的下划線-->
    }
    

四.不允許對文本操作樣式

  • 不允許文本操作:user-select: none;


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M